Note: We have organized the cemeteries in our Gazetteer based on a problem that we had while working on our own genealogy. As an example and without specifying the cemeteries involved, we found an ancestor that we believed to have been buried in one cemetery had actually been buried elsewhere.
We discovered that his burial plans had changed at the last moment and the family had scrambled to make new arrangements. By looking at nearby cemeteries, the surrounding communities and in newspapers of the period, we were finally able to locate his burial site.

The Location of the Weiss Cemetery ...
We are using the following GPS coordinates (latitude and longitude) for the Weiss Cemetery:
30.1288, -96.4172
Note: The GPS location that we are using for the Weiss Cemetery can be traced back to the Geographic Names Information System (GNIS)<1>
The Weiss Cemetery is located in Washington County<2>.
The county seat for Washington County is located in Brenham. Brenham lies just to the north northeast of the Weiss Cemetery .
